Social media polarization reflects shifting political alliances in Pakistan (2309.08075v1)

Published 15 Sep 2023 in cs.SI and cs.CY

Abstract: The rise of ideological divides in public discourse has received considerable attention in recent years. However, much of this research has been concentrated on Western democratic nations, leaving other regions largely unexplored. Here, we delve into the political landscape of Pakistan, a nation marked by intricate political dynamics and persistent turbulence. Spanning from 2018 to 2022, our analysis of Twitter data allows us to capture pivotal shifts and developments in Pakistan's political arena. By examining interactions and content generated by politicians affiliated with major political parties, we reveal a consistent and active presence of politicians on Twitter, with opposition parties exhibiting particularly robust engagement. We explore the alignment of party audiences, highlighting a notable convergence among opposition factions over time. Our analysis also uncovers significant shifts in political affiliations, including the transition of politicians to the opposition alliance. Quantitatively, we assess evolving interaction patterns, showcasing the prevalence of homophilic connections while identifying a growing interconnection among audiences of opposition parties. Our study, by accurately reflecting shifts in the political landscape, underscores the reliability of our methodology and social media data as a valuable tool for monitoring political polarization and providing a nuanced understanding of macro-level trends and individual-level transformations.
